Short term the only way forward seemed to be to make deployment-mx its own
puppetmaster. So I did that, modified local site.pp to leave out
role::mail::sender, and added beta::puppetmaster::sync so it should stay in
sync otherwise. Once I generate some labs-use DKIM keys we should be in
business.

Long term it sounds like heira is the way to go.

I just hope by long term you mean "immediately following this proof of
concept". I really really don't want a special snowflake host in beta
that uses a different set of hacked puppet code than the project wide
hacked puppet code we already have to deal with.

I hope so too, especially considering all this effort is to accomplish a one character (#) diff from origin/production. But I can't take on heira myself at this time, and I don't know how this fits into overall priorities.
